ELAA recommends action on national early learning masterplan

30 Apr 2023

Currently, there is no overarching national strategy to support the early years in Australia – no plan to ensure all Australian children have the same access to the best quality Early Childhood Education and Care (ECEC) and no plan to harness the evidence-based benefits of quality early childhood education for all children, families, society, and the economy.

Early Learning Association Australia (ELAA) has joined the national response to bridge this gap through a submission to the Commonwealth Government’s ‘Early Years Strategy’.

New Vic early years infrastructure announcement presents significant opportunities

3 Apr 2023

The Victorian Government has announced significant infrastructure assistance for Early Childhood Education and Care (ECEC) services with the release of new funding guidelines over the weekend. This assistance will take services another step closer to realising the benefits of the Government’s $9 billion ‘Best Start Best Life’ kindergarten reform program.
